JAKARTA Texas Attorney General Ken senjak, sued Roblox on Thursday, November 6, 2025. Through this lawsuit, Roblox is accused of defrauding parents about the risk of children's safety.
The online gaming platform, which is popular in various parts of the world, including Indonesia, is referred to as a 'struce for child predators and sexual exploitation'. Attorney General from Kentucky and Louisiana is known to have joined this lawsuit.
"We can't let platforms like Roblox continue to operate as a digital playground for predators,"dors said in a statement.
After this lawsuit was filed, Roblox gave a firm statement. The company bought itself by stating that it has a strong security protocol, unlike the allegations.
Roblox also claims that they have implemented various controls to eliminate criminals and protect their users. One of them is control for parents to limit communication on their children's accounts.
Parents and guardians can also limit content that enters their children's accounts. This shows Roblox's commitment to strengthening its security even though control is still in the hands of parents.

In addition, the San Mateo-based company, California, also does not allow users to share images. In a larger effort to keep the platform safe, Roblox admits to actively cooperating with law enforcement.
Roblox also expressed his disappointment with the mitigation lawsuit. According to him,ition should work together to find a solution to the 'challenges in the industry'. For Roblox, this lawsuit is based on a 'mis-representation and sensational claim'.
In its latest third-quarter report, Roblox recorded an average of 151.5 million daily active users. Data in 2024 shows that 40 percent of the daily active users are under the age of 13. There is no new data yet for this year.
